Win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Johnson City). They blew past the Lohn Eagles, posting an 86-18 win.
Johnson City's victory was a true team effort,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Preston Craig, who went 8 of 10 on his way to 20 points and six boards. The team also got some help courtesy of Brady Odiorne, who went 8 for 12 on his way to 20 points and five rebounds.
The win got Johnson City back to even at 2-2. As for Lohn, they are on an eight-game losing streak (dating back to last season) that has dropped them down to 0-3.
Johnson City did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next match, a 63-43 victory against Lometa on the 6th. As for Lohn, they will have a little extra prep time after the defeat as they won't be playing again for a while. They'll take on Menard at 7:00 p.m. on December 20th.
